Meaning of Fitz
Son of, son or male descendant, son of the king.
Origin of Fitz
The name 'Fitz' finds its origins in medieval England, where it was commonly used as a patronymic surname. It denoted the status of being the son of a nobleman or a member of the gentry. For example, a man named John who was the son of a nobleman named Richard would be known as John 'Fitz'Richard. Over time, this surname transitioned into a given name, allowing individuals to carry the prestigious lineage of their ancestors.

Etymology of Fitz

The etymology of the name 'Fitz' is deeply rooted in the Old French language. As mentioned earlier, it is derived from the word 'fils', meaning 'son'. This linguistic connection highlights the historical connection between England and France, as well as the influence of the French language on the English naming tradition.
